2002 FIFA World Cup qualification – CAF Final Round
The CAF Final Round of 2002 FIFA World Cup qualification was contested between the 25 winners from the First Round split across 5 groups.
The top country in each group at the end of the stage progressed to the 2002 FIFA World Cup.

Guinea were excluded on 19 March 2001 after the Guinean sports minister had failed to meet a third FIFA deadline to reinstall the Guinean FA functionaries. Their match results were annulled
